How often do you change the oilfilter in a 1999 Pontiac Grand Am?

Every time you change the oil, change the filter. I recommend every 5,000 miles and I also recommend you use an AC/Delco filter, which is highly rated.

How often do you change the oil in a 1999 Pontiac Grand Am?

you should change your engine oil in any car when, A. you have driven 3,000 miles since your last oil change, or B. you have gone 3 months since your last oil change. this keeps all of the sludge and dirt out of your oil galleries and off of your bearings and journals... in english, it keeps your engine clean, improves emissions and will keep your car running longer.

How often does a timing chain in a 2002 Pontiac Grand Prix GT have to be done?

The timing chain is designed to last the life of the engine and is normally only replaced during a complete engine rebuild.
